Error: {'error': {'code': 'PowerBINotAuthorizedException' when calling executeQueries API

Hi ,

i am now stuck in a error when calling power bi API: https://api.powerbi.com/v1.0/myorg/groups/xxxxx/datasets/xx/executeQueries.

i have two datasets A and B in same workspace.

i call the API ,

https://api.powerbi.com/v1.0/myorg/groups/xxxxx/datasets/A/executeQueries.

and https://api.powerbi.com/v1.0/myorg/groups/xxxxx/datasets/B/executeQueries.

with query: "EVALUATE ROW(\"currentDate\", TODAY())" respectively.

one success but one failed with error: 

{'error': {'code': 'PowerBINotAuthorizedException', 'pbi.error': {'code': 'PowerBINotAuthorizedException', 'parameters': {}, 'details': [], 'exceptionCulprit': 1}}}

 

Can anyone give me some suggestions for the root cause?

Thanks

Hi @pennyhoho117 ,

Base on your description, it seems you got the error when calling executeQueries API for one of datasets in the same workspace. One can work, the other one get PowerBINotAuthorizedException error. The following thread is the one which has the similar problem as yours, hope its solution can help you solve the problem.

Solved: PowerBI API Returns "PowerBINotAuthorizedException... - Microsoft Fabric Community

When you use the admin api you need to grant access to this in the tenant admin. Because you use service principal this need to be added in a security group, and this group needs to be granted admin api access in the tenant admin portal.

When this is done, I,ve experienced it can take up to 20-30 min before it works.
